Description

" Retirement Apartment For Persons Aged 60 Years Of Age

Located on the second floor is this two bedroom corner flat which has been neutrally decorated giving it a lovely homely feel and is offered in good condition throughout.

The property consists of a bright and airy reception room with a commanding view of the recreation grounds in the distance, fully fitted kitchen with a window, bathroom, master bedroom with built in wardrobes, second bedroom ideal for a study, dining room or a guest room.

With the apartment being on the top floor and at the end of the corridor it further benefits from being a very quiet flat due to the lack of residents having to pass by, as well as being close enough to the lift without being disturbed. There is only one adjoining neighbour and as there is no one above you it is guaranteed you won t be disturbed by neighbours if noise is a concern.

Gibson Court is set in well maintained private gardens, and with the grounds situated back from Manor Road North via private road, the development offers all the benefits of a peaceful lifestyle. The area is very well served by local shops situated only 0.2 miles away with a parade of stores on one side and a pretty village square setting on the other. They include a baker, family butcher, chemist, doctors surgery, small supermarket and Post Office, newsagents, hairdressers, hardware and electrical store as well as several other useful establishments.

Hinchley Wood is equally well served by public transport links with a regular bus service to Claygate and Esher in one direction and Surbiton and Kingston in the other. In addition, Hinchley Wood Station has fast train links both into London and out to Guildford.

The development itself consists of both 1 and 2 bedroom apartments, with onsite laundry and parking, a residents lounge, guest suite and resident House Manager. Gibson Court benefits from a brand new Door Entry System as well as a Warden Call Service which has been installed in all communal areas and apartments. From its pretty surrounding gardens and convenient location to the relaxing living rooms, Gibson Court is an ideal retirement choice.

SERVICE CHARGE ?3,276.00 PA
GROUND RENT ?574.16 PA
LEASE LENGTH 95 Years Remaining
